Flat 7, Malthouse Court Sea Lane, Hayle, TR27 4DU is a leasehold flat built before 1900. The property offers approximately 388 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£141,481 , which equates to approximately £365 per square foot. It was last sold on 7 Feb 2023 for £150,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£8,519, representing a 5.7% decrease, or approximately 2.0% per year.

The current estimated value of £141,481 is:

  • 33.5% lower than the average property price on Sea Lane
  • 5.8% lower than the average in the TR27 4DU postcode area
  • and 55.3% lower than the average price for Hayle as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 23 May 2022,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

Flat 7, Malthouse Court Sea Lane, Hayle, Cornwall, TR27 4DU has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 23 May 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 25 Jun 2009, and the property received the same rating of C with an unchanged energy efficiency score of 76.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, mains gas to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from gas multipoint to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from average to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from granite or whin, as built, insulated (assumed) to granite or whinstone,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 57%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
